“That is the basic pattern of this kind of meditation, which is based on three fundamental factors: first, not centralizing inward; second, not having any longing to become higher; and third, becoming completely identified with here and now.”

Chogyam Trungpa

About This Quote

Source Book: Cutting Through Spiritual Materialism, Chogyam Trungpa, 1973

Meditation should avoid self‑absorption, desire for superiority, and focus on present awareness.

In simple terms: Stay present, let go of ego and ambition.
